What's Happening?
Calvin Klein, renowned for his impact on American fashion, recently appeared on Vogue's Run-Through podcast to discuss his design legacy. Klein emphasized the importance of modernity through simplicity, advocating for designs that focus on good shape and silhouette without excessive decoration. He reflected on his career, highlighting his influence on American women’s fashion during a time of newfound freedom. Klein's streamlined slip dresses and sleek suits continue to define American minimalism, serving as a template for contemporary designers.
